Yes, songs can be imported to Spotify. You can do this by navigating to the Settings in the Spotify app, then enabling 'Local Files'. After this, you can choose folders on your computer that contain your music files. These files will then be available in your Library under 'Local Files'. This feature allows you to enjoy your favorite tracks within the Spotify interface, even if they're not available on the platform.
FAQs & Answers
- Can I import any song format to Spotify? Spotify supports common audio formats like MP3, MP4, and M4P for local file imports, but some formats may not be compatible.
- Will imported local files sync to other devices on Spotify? Local files imported on one device will only be available on that device unless you enable local file syncing on other devices within the same network.
- How do I find my imported songs in Spotify? After enabling Local Files in Settings, imported songs appear under the 'Local Files' section in your Spotify library.
